1.1 Overview of Winch Cable Guide Rollers

Winch cable guide rollers are critical components designed to direct and manage winch cables‚ ensuring smooth operation and minimizing wear. They are essential for guiding the cable onto the winch drum‚ preventing issues like bird nesting and uneven spooling. Made from high-quality materials such as high carbon steel‚ these rollers are built to withstand heavy-duty applications. Many feature spring-loaded designs to maintain constant tension‚ reducing slack and improving cable winding efficiency. They are widely used in off-road recovery‚ industrial‚ and marine applications‚ ensuring reliable performance in demanding conditions. Proper alignment and installation of these rollers are vital for maintaining cable integrity and extending the lifespan of the winch system.

2.3 Spring-Loaded Design for Constant Tension

Winch cable guide rollers often feature a spring-loaded design that maintains constant tension on the cable‚ eliminating slack and ensuring even spooling on the drum. This mechanism improves cable winding efficiency and reduces wear caused by loose or unevenly wound cables. The spring-loaded system provides consistent pressure‚ preventing bird nesting and ensuring smooth operation during pulls. High-quality rollers use durable materials like bronze bushings to support the spring action‚ enhancing longevity and performance. This design is particularly beneficial in heavy-duty applications‚ where maintaining proper cable tension is critical for reliable and safe winching operations. 6.1 Proper Installation Techniques

Proper installation of winch cable guide rollers is crucial for optimal performance. Ensure the roller is aligned correctly with the winch drum to prevent cable damage; Use high-strength hardware and follow manufacturer guidelines for bolt torque specifications. Secure the roller to the vehicle’s frame or a sturdy mounting point to handle the intended load capacity. Test the system under light load to confirm smooth cable movement and proper alignment. Refer to the product manual for specific installation instructions‚ as improper mounting can lead to uneven spooling or reduced efficiency. Always double-check the roller’s position and tension before operational use.

6.2 Regular Maintenance Tips

Regular maintenance of winch cable guide rollers ensures longevity and optimal performance. Inspect rollers for wear‚ corrosion‚ or damage‚ replacing them if necessary. Lubricate moving parts periodically to reduce friction and prevent seizing. Clean debris or dirt from the rollers and surrounding areas to maintain smooth cable movement. Check the alignment of the roller with the winch drum and adjust if misaligned. Ensure all bolts and fasteners are tightened to the manufacturer’s specifications. Replace any worn or corroded components promptly to prevent cable damage. Regularly test the system under light load to ensure proper function and make adjustments as needed. Consistent upkeep prevents operational issues and extends the life of the roller and cable.

8.1 Factors to Consider

When selecting a winch cable guide roller‚ consider load capacity‚ material quality‚ and durability. High carbon steel rollers with bronze bushings offer longevity‚ while zinc-plated or powder-coated finishes resist corrosion. Ensure compatibility with your winch system‚ including cable type (steel or synthetic) and maximum cable diameter. Spring-loaded designs maintain constant tension‚ preventing slack and improving spooling. Assess the roller’s ability to handle angle pulls and reduce friction. Proper alignment and installation are crucial for optimal performance. Choose models with sealed ball bearings for smoother operation. Finally‚ check warranty and brand reputation to ensure reliability and support.
